Factors to Consider When Choosing a Router With VPN Support for Business

When choosing a router with VPN support for your business, you need to take into account several key factors. Look at VPN protocol compatibility and evaluate the security features to guarantee your data stays protected. Don’t forget to check the performance and speed, as well as the number of connections and port configuration options that suit your needs.

VPN Protocol Compatibility

Choosing a router that supports a variety of VPN protocols is vital for meeting your business’s security needs and ensuring compatibility with different devices. Look for routers that support OpenVPN, L2TP, and PPTP to accommodate varying security requirements. It’s also important to select a router that can handle multiple simultaneous connections, with some capable of supporting over 50 OpenVPN connections for efficient operations. Additionally, routers with features like VPN pass-through and IPsec support enhance security and enable seamless remote access. Make sure the router complies with the latest WPA3 security protocols to protect sensitive data. Finally, consider models that allow VPN cascading, enabling you to use both a VPN server and client simultaneously for added flexibility.

Security Features Evaluation

As you evaluate routers with VPN support for your business, prioritizing security features is essential to safeguard sensitive data and maintain network integrity. Look for advanced firewall policies, including SPI Firewall and DoS defense, to defend against unauthorized access and cyber threats. Routers that support IP/MAC/URL filtering allow you to customize security settings, restricting access to specific devices or websites. Make certain the router offers support for multiple VPN protocols like OpenVPN, L2TP, and PPTP for flexibility. Built-in features such as DNS over HTTPS/TLS and WPA3 enhance privacy and protect against data eavesdropping. Finally, consider cloud management options to manage network security remotely, enabling real-time monitoring and adjustments from anywhere.

Performance and Speed

To guarantee your business runs smoothly, it’s essential to take into account performance and speed when selecting a router with VPN support. Look for routers that support high-speed protocols like OpenVPN and WireGuard, achieving speeds up to 900 Mbps, perfect for data-intensive tasks. Choosing routers with the latest Wi-Fi standards, such as Wi-Fi 6 or Wi-Fi 7, can provide speeds up to 6 Gbps, ensuring seamless connections and reduced latency. Multi-band capabilities help distribute bandwidth effectively, allowing multiple devices to connect without sacrificing speed. Additionally, advanced technologies like MU-MIMO and OFDMA allow for simultaneous communication with multiple devices, maximizing network efficiency. Don’t forget to check the router’s CPU and RAM for peak performance under high data throughput demands.

Number of Connections

When selecting a router for your business, the number of simultaneous connections it can handle is crucial for maintaining efficient network performance. A router that supports a high number of connections guarantees multiple users and devices can operate seamlessly, even during peak times. Some advanced models can accommodate up to 150,000 associated clients, making them ideal for larger businesses. If you have remote workers, you’ll need a router capable of supporting multiple VPN connections, typically ranging from 20 to over 100 tunnels. This guarantees that all employees can securely access the company network without experiencing lag or performance issues. Balancing a high connection capacity with robust processing power is essential for peak network speed and reliability.

Port Configuration Options

Choosing the right router for your business involves more than just connection capacity; port configuration options play a significant role in optimizing your network’s performance. First, consider the number of WAN ports. Multiple WAN ports can enhance bandwidth usage and provide redundancy for your internet connections. Look for routers with Gigabit Ethernet ports to guarantee high-speed connections for various devices and applications, like video conferencing. USB WAN ports can also offer backup mobile broadband options. Additionally, check the configuration of LAN ports; having several LAN ports allows direct connections to devices, boosting network stability. Finally, make sure your router supports advanced features like load balancing to distribute traffic efficiently across WAN connections, further improving overall performance.
